The carbon monoxide dot structure shows a carbon atom bonded to an oxygen atom with a triple bond. This arrangement indicates that the carbon and oxygen atoms share three pairs of electrons, forming a strong and stable bond.

What arrangement of balls serves as the best model for this structure?

The best arrangement of balls to model a structure typically depends on the specific characteristics of that structure. For example, if you're modeling a crystalline solid, a close-packed arrangement like face-centered cubic (FCC) or hexagonal close-packed (HCP) would be ideal. Alternatively, for a molecular structure like a benzene ring, a planar arrangement with equal spacing between the balls (representing atoms) would be more suitable. The choice of arrangement should reflect the spatial and bonding properties of the structure being modeled.

What are the differences between electron dot structure and Lewis dot structure?

The electron dot structure and Lewis dot structure are the same thing. They both represent the arrangement of valence electrons in an atom or molecule using dots around the chemical symbol.

What is the relationship between deep structure and surface structure in linguistic analysis?

In linguistic analysis, deep structure refers to the underlying meaning of a sentence, while surface structure refers to the actual arrangement of words in a sentence. The relationship between the two is that deep structure influences the creation of surface structure, as the underlying meaning of a sentence determines how it is expressed through word order and grammar.
